In a game heard on AM 1370 WDEA and WDEA Internet Radio the Ellsworth Softball Team fell to the Brewer Witches 6-4 on Thursday afternoon, May 16th.

Brewer jumped out to a 3-0 lead in the top of the 1st inning as Becca Gideon blasted a home run over the fence.

Ellsworth battled back in the bottom of the 1st inning. Sara Shea tripled to start the inning and Ellie Clarke walked. Trinity Montigny grounded into a fielder's choice scoring Shea. Kayla Duhaime drove the ball over the fence for a 2 run homer, to tie the score 3-3.

Brewer added a run in the 3rd inning as Kenzie Dore singled, scoring Jordan Goodrich, to make it 4-3 Brewer.

Ellsworth left the bases loaded in the bottom of the 3rd.

The Witches added 2 runs in the top of the 5th inning. Libby Hewes singled, Kenzie Dore doubled, driving in Hewes and then Becca Dideon doubled, driving in Dore. That made the score 6-3 Brewer.

In the bottom of the 5th Ellsworth stranded Sara Shea at 3rd and in the bottom of the 6th inning Kayla Duhaime was stranded at 3rd base.

In the bottom of the 7th Lexi Rossi started the inning with walk and stole 2nd base. She advanced to 3rd on a passed ball and then scored on a sacrifice fly by Sara Shea.

Libby Hewes pitched a complete game for Brewer. She struck out 6 and allowed 7 hits.

Kenzie Chipman threw 5 innings for Ellsworth allowing 6 runs on 9 hits and walked 2. Tyler Hellum pitched 2 innings, not allowing a run and struck out 2, while walking 3 and giving up 1 hit.

For Ellsworth Sara Shea had a triple and single.Kayla Duhaime had a home run and a double. Ellie Clarke had a double. Trinity Montigny had a single.

For Brewer Kenzie Dore had 2 doubles and a single. Becca Gideon had a home run, a double and a single. Jordan Goodrich and Libby Hewes each had 2 singles

Ellsworth is now 7-3 and will play at GSA on Friday, May 17th at 4:30

Brewer is undefeated and 11-0. They will play host to Bangor on Friday, May 17th at 6:30
